Jenna was lying on the bed when she heard Hansen's shout. Appalled, she sat up and her heart skipped a beat when she heard him calling 'Larry'. An ominous feeling immediately hit her.
"Mr. Richards, I was playing with Jerry at the Ocean Park. He was having a good time. Then, we went to the restroom. He insisted on going to the gents. I couldn't follow him. So, I stood outside and waited. After waiting for a long time, he didn't come out. Then, I called him again and again outside. He did not reply. I became flustered and asked the men who came out, but they said they didn't see any kids in there. I was scared and immediately got a security guard to go in and looked for him. Then, we separated and looked for him, using the announcement. But our efforts are in vain. Jerry went missing for no reason." Larry tried her best to speak properly through the phone. At the end, she burst into tears. Then, she apologised. "I'm sorry, Mr. Richards. I lost Jerry. I'm so sorry, I'm so sorry..."
Larry had already burst into tears on the phone. She was not only afraid, but also sad. After all, she had brought up Jerry for a long time. Right then he had disappeared. Her heart was burning like a fire, and she was in anguish.
Hansen's face instantly turned pale. He clutched the phone tightly and blue veins popped out on his skin.
He was not afraid that he himself would face any danger, but he could not allow his loved ones to get into any accident, especially when Jerry was still a child.
At that moment, he was scared out of his wits.
"Larry, look around nearby. I'll be right there." He tried his best to calm down and ordered gravely.
After putting down the phone, he turned around.
His heart started to palpitate.
Jenna's face was deathly pale as she stared directly at him. Cold sweat broke out on her forehead and the tip of her nose.
Her face was terribly blanched, and there was only despair and pain in her eyes.
"Hansen, tell me. Jerry, could it be that Jerry has gone missing?" she asked in a trembling voice. Her voice was both bitter and heavy.
Hansen's heart throbbed painfully. Gradually, the pain spread to his limbs, as if there was a sharp knife stabbing at his heart.
"Jenna, don't worry. It's fine. With me here, Jerry will definitely be fine." There was no way to hide such a thing from her. Furthermore, she was already very close to listening to the conversation. So, he could only reach out and try to comfort her.
"No, Jerry, my child." Jenna let out a shrill cry, and her vision turned black as she fell limply onto the bed.
"Jenna, Jenna." Hansen was heartbroken and bent down to pick her up.
